About us
Lemay Consulting is a full service company. We have been in business since 1984 with over 19,000 Home Inspections performed. We are a member of A.S.H.I. ( American Society of Home Inspectors) #201927, A professional Inspection performed in accordance with the Standards and Ethics of A.S.H.I., and N.A.R.R.E.P. All test will conform to the E.P.A., F.H.A. and or V.A. Standards. State Licensed Home Inspector in MA & N.H., MA state licensed Construction Supervisor Lic. # CS-023934, Ma State licensed Energy Conservationist, MA State Licensed Lead Inspectors #1051(Greg) & #3764(Michelle) (XRF Technology Testing Equipment). We are fully Insured with Professional Errors & Omissions and General Liability. Certificate of Insurance upon request. Payment at time of inspections either Cash or Check.

I, am a potential bidder for a property in Shrewsbury, MA (the “Property”). The property was listed as a sealed bid and purchase “As-Is.” However, potential buyers are allowed the conduct home inspections prior to submitting a bid.
Following is a list of events:
May 18, 2016:
I scheduled with Mr. Gregory J. Lemay to conduct the home inspection on May 18, 2016 at 9:00 AM at the Property. I informed Mr. Lemay that this is a bidding process and we planned to submit the bid by Friday, May 20, 2016. The realtor, the listing agent, my husband were all present during the inspection. The inspection ended prior to 11:00 AM.
Mr. Lemay walked through the exterior and then the first floor. Prior to inspecting the basement, he requested us to make payments and sign the Contract for Service. He promised to provide the home inspection report by the end of that day, May 18, 2016. During the inspection, I accompanied him the whole time and took notes. Please note that the Contract for Service stated the inspection was from 8:45 AM to 12:00 PM. However, he did not arrive until 9:04 AM and left prior to 11:00 AM. I believe this is misrepresentation and do not meet professional licensing code of conduct.
May 19, 2016
I did not receive the report by the end of May 18, 2016 and I called Mr. Lemay on May 19, 2016 at 11:01 AM. Mr. Lemay stated that he had a dinner party the night before and did not get to the report. He promised to email me the report by the end of May 19, 2016. I also sent Mr. Lemay an email to make sure he has my correct email address.
May 20, 2016
My realtor informed me that she is ready to submit the bid by noon that day. I told her that I still have not received the inspection report. I called Mr. Lemay at 8:55 AM to inform him that I need to have the report prior to submitting the bid. Mr. Lemay told me that he will be emailing me the report in 10 minutes. However, by 10:30 AM, my realtor has to leave her office to submit the bid. I still did not receive the report. I emailed Mr. Lemay and stated that his report did not provide any value as I could not review it prior to submitting the bid. I requested a refund of the inspection fee.
May 21, 2016
I did not receive any response from Mr. Lemay, either by phone call, text, or email. I called him at 10:08 AM and stated my request for a refund. He claimed that he had already emailed me the report. Later I double checked my email, I did not see his report. He was very upset on the phone and even called me “crazy woman.” I told him that his service did not meet the professional conduct requirements in CMR 266.6.00 and he did not treat me professionally. If he had experienced difficulty, I have given him enough time to produce the report. Per his website, the report was promised same day or next day. However, the report was not received more than 48 hours after the inspection. His failure to provide the written report caused me a lost of opportunity to obtain other home inspections prior to submitting the bid. I requested for a full refund again.
May 26, 2016
I still have not received the report nor the refund. I filed a complaint with the MA Licensing Board with all the receipts and documents and was assigned a docket # HI-16-015. I also filed a complaint with the consumer affair office to mediate on the refund process.
